Hydraulic fluid \u2014 typically mineral oil, though water-glycol and synthetic fire-resistant fluids are used in hazardous environments \u2014 is pumped into one or both chambers of a steel barrel. The differential pressure acting on the piston&#8217;s cross-sectional area generates an axial force governed by the fundamental relationship F = P \u00d7 A, where F is force in Newtons, P is gauge pressure in Pascals, and A is the effective piston area in square metres. In a double-acting cylinder design, the extend stroke is powered by pressure applied to the full-bore (cap-end) side, while the retract stroke uses the annular (rod-end) area. Sealing systems \u2014 comprising rod seals, piston seals, wiper rings, and guide bands \u2014 maintain the pressure differential while controlling internal and external leakage. The motor (typically a servo or stepper unit) drives the screw shaft, which threads through a nut attached to the output rod, converting rotation into translation. Feedback from an encoder or resolver provides closed-loop position data to the controller, enabling sub-millimetre or even micrometre repeatability in precision applications. Force output depends on the motor&#8217;s torque, the screw&#8217;s lead (pitch), and the mechanical efficiency of the transmission; electric actuators rarely exceed 100\u2013150 kN in standard catalogue configurations, though purpose-built roller-screw units can approach 300\u2013400 kN. A hydraulic cylinder with a 200mm bore operating at 250 bar (25 MPa) develops an extension force of approximately 785 kN from a package that weighs perhaps 80\u2013120 kg, depending on stroke and material specification. Achieving equivalent force from an electric roller-screw actuator demands a substantially heavier, longer, and costlier assembly. Telescopic hydraulic cylinders \u2014 multi-stage designs where successive tubes nest inside each other \u2014 can achieve deployed lengths several times the collapsed dimension. This geometry is physically impossible to replicate with a lead-screw or ball-screw actuator of comparable rated load without compromising column-load buckling resistance. Tipper bodies, refuse compactors, and the raising mechanisms of bridge cranes in British port facilities rely on this exact capability daily. The hydraulic cylinder&#8217;s ability to hold its extended position under full load without electrical power consumption \u2014 because a closed valve simply traps incompressible fluid \u2014 is another practical advantage in safety-critical holding applications.<\/p>\n<\/div>\n<\/div>\n<p><!-- Stats row --><\/p>\n<div style=\"display: flex; flex-wrap: wrap; gap: 16px; margin-top: 28px; box-sizing: border-box;\">\n<div style=\"flex: 1 1 140px; min-width: 0; background: linear-gradient(135deg, #0072ff, #00c6ff); border-radius: 12px; padding: 3%; text-align: center; box-sizing: border-box; transition: transform 0.25s;\">\n<div style=\"font-size: clamp(24px,4vw,38px); font-weight: 800; color: #fff;\">785 kN<\/div>\n<div style=\"color: rgba(255,255,255,0.85); font-size: clamp(11px,1.5vw,13px); margin-top: 4px;\">Typical hydraulic force @ 250 bar, 200mm bore<\/div>\n<\/div>\n<div style=\"flex: 1 1 140px; min-width: 0; background: linear-gradient(135deg, #e67e22, #f39c12); border-radius: 12px; padding: 3%; text-align: center; box-sizing: border-box; transition: transform 0.25s;\">\n<div style=\"font-size: clamp(24px,4vw,38px); font-weight: 800; color: #fff;\">\u2264400 kN<\/div>\n<div style=\"color: rgba(255,255,255,0.85); font-size: clamp(11px,1.5vw,13px); margin-top: 4px;\">Max practical electric linear actuator (roller screw)<\/div>\n<\/div>\n<div style=\"flex: 1 1 140px; min-width: 0; background: linear-gradient(135deg, #27ae60, #2ecc71); border-radius: 12px; padding: 3%; text-align: center; box-sizing: border-box; transition: transform 0.25s;\">\n<div style=\"font-size: clamp(24px,4vw,38px); font-weight: 800; color: #fff;\">5\u00d7 +<\/div>\n<div style=\"color: rgba(255,255,255,0.85); font-size: clamp(11px,1.5vw,13px); margin-top: 4px;\">Telescopic stroke-to-retracted length ratio achievable<\/div>\n<\/div>\n<div style=\"flex: 1 1 140px; min-width: 0; background: linear-gradient(135deg, #8e44ad, #9b59b6); border-radius: 12px; padding: 3%; text-align: center; box-sizing: border-box; transition: transform 0.25s;\">\n<div style=\"font-size: clamp(24px,4vw,38px); font-weight: 800; color: #fff;\">0 W<\/div>\n<div style=\"color: rgba(255,255,255,0.85); font-size: clamp(11px,1.5vw,13px); margin-top: 4px;\">Power draw at full-load static hold (hydraulic)<\/div>\n<\/div>\n<\/div>\n<\/div>\n<p><!-- SECTION: PRECISION & CONTROL --><\/p>\n<div style=\"width: 100%; max-width: 100%; min-width: 100%; background: #f4f7fb; padding: 3% 4%; box-sizing: border-box;\">\n<h2 style=\"font-size: clamp(18px, 3vw + 6px, 30px); color: #0a1628; margin: 0 0 20px 0; padding-bottom: 10px; border-bottom: 3px solid #e67e22;\">Precision Control, Repeatability, and Programmability: Where Electric Actuators Lead<\/h2>\n<div style=\"display: flex; flex-wrap: wrap; gap: 20px; box-sizing: border-box;\">\n<div style=\"flex: 2 1 300px; min-width: 0;\">\n<p><img decoding=\"async\" style=\"width: 100%; max-width: 100%; height: auto; border-radius: 10px; box-shadow: 0 8px 24px rgba(0,0,0,0.10); display: block;\" src=\"https:\/\/boom-cylinders.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/09\/ep-boom-cylinders.com-3-1.webp\" alt=\"Hydraulic cylinder precision manufacturing\" title=\"\"><\/p>\n<p style=\"font-size: clamp(13px,1.8vw,16px); color: #34495e; line-height: 1.85; margin: 0 0 16px 0;\">Where an application calls for sub-millimetre positioning accuracy, multi-point programmable stops, real-time force profiling, or integration with Industry 4.0 data acquisition systems, the electric linear actuator generally outperforms an equivalently sized hydraulic cylinder without additional proportional valve hardware. A servo-driven ball-screw actuator can achieve bidirectional repeatability of \u00b10.02 mm as standard, with some specialist units reaching \u00b10.005 mm. Achieving equivalent accuracy with a hydraulic cylinder requires the addition of a servo proportional valve, a linear encoder on the cylinder rod, a high-bandwidth controller, and careful management of fluid temperature and compressibility \u2014 all of which add cost, complexity, and calibration burden. Velocity profiles, acceleration ramps, dwell times, and force limits can all be configured entirely in software through the drive&#8217;s parameterisation interface, without changing any mechanical hardware. Over-the-air firmware updates and remote diagnostics through OPC-UA or EtherCAT reduce maintenance engineer travel to site \u2014 a consideration that matters for remote installations in the UK&#8217;s offshore energy or upland wind sectors. Hydraulic systems can achieve comparable programmability, but the path runs through servo valve selection, hydraulic power unit sizing, and manifold design \u2014 a longer, more expensive engineering journey that is only justifiable when the force demands exceed what any electric actuator can deliver.<\/p>\n<\/div>\n<\/div>\n<\/div>\n<p><!-- SECTION: PERFORMANCE PARAMETERS TABLE --><\/p>\n<div style=\"width: 100%; Yield strength of 355 MPa provides the burst and fatigue resistance needed for continuous duty at 200\u2013350 bar. Internal honing to Ra 0.2\u20130.4 \u00b5m ensures seal longevity across millions of cycles.<\/p>\n<\/div>\n<div style=\"flex: 1 1 200px; min-width: 0; background: #fff; border-radius: 12px; padding: 3%; box-sizing: border-box; border-top: 4px solid #e67e22; box-shadow: 0 4px 16px rgba(0,0,0,0.07); transition: transform 0.25s, box-shadow 0.25s;\">\n<div style=\"font-size: clamp(20px,3vw,28px);\">\u2699\ufe0f<\/div>\n<div style=\"font-weight: bold; color: #e67e22; margin: 6px 0 8px; font-size: clamp(13px,1.8vw,16px);\">Piston Rod \u2014 45# Chrome Steel<\/div>\n<p style=\"font-size: clamp(12px,1.6vw,14px); color: #555; line-height: 1.75; margin: 0;\">The piston rod bears direct compressive and tensile loads during every stroke cycle. High-performance polyurethane (PU) rod seals handle pressures to 400 bar with excellent abrasion resistance. PTFE-based guide strips manage lateral load while minimising friction and stick-slip. FKM (Viton\u00ae) O-rings are specified for high-temperature or fire-resistant-fluid applications above 80\u00b0C.<\/p>\n<\/div>\n<div style=\"flex: 1 1 200px; min-width: 0; background: #fff; border-radius: 12px; padding: 3%; box-sizing: border-box; border-top: 4px solid #8e44ad; box-shadow: 0 4px 16px rgba(0,0,0,0.07); transition: transform 0.25s, box-shadow 0.25s;\">\n<div style=\"font-size: clamp(20px,3vw,28px);\">\ud83c\udfd7\ufe0f<\/div>\n<div style=\"font-weight: bold; color: #8e44ad; margin: 6px 0 8px; font-size: clamp(13px,1.8vw,16px);\">End Caps &amp; Mountings \u2014 Forged \/ Cast Steel<\/div>\n<p style=\"font-size: clamp(12px,1.6vw,14px); color: #555; line-height: 1.75; margin: 0;\">Cylinder heads and cap ends are produced from forged or ductile iron (GGG-40) or steel castings, machined to tight tolerances. Operating pressures of 200\u2013350 bar, continuous duty cycles, and ambient temperatures ranging from near-freezing in winter to 60\u00b0C+ near furnace lines make electric actuators largely unsuitable. Hydraulic cylinders with mineral-oil working fluid, high-temperature FKM seals, and stainless rod coatings are the standard specification across the city&#8217;s long-product steel mills, forges, and plate processing facilities. The ability to hold heavy platform and payload loads without powered actuation through simple check valve technology is a fundamental safety requirement under PUWER and LOLER regulations governing work-at-height equipment in the UK. Hydraulic cylinders used in AWP boom angle control, such as those designed for folding and primary boom applications, must pass stringent fatigue testing and carry certifications aligned with EN 280 (mobile elevating work platforms) standards.<\/p>\n<\/div>\n<p><!-- App Card 3 --><\/p>\n<div style=\"flex: 1 1 260px; min-width: 0; background: #f4f7fb; border-radius: 14px; padding: 3%; box-sizing: border-box; border-left: 5px solid #27ae60; transition: transform 0.25s, box-shadow 0.25s;\">\n<div style=\"font-size: clamp(22px,3vw,30px);\">\u2693<\/div>\n<div style=\"font-weight: bold; color: #27ae60; font-size: clamp(14px,2vw,17px); margin: 6px 0 8px;\">Marine &amp; Offshore \u2014 Aberdeen, North Sea Operations<\/div>\n<p style=\"font-size: clamp(12px,1.6vw,14px); color: #34495e; line-height: 1.8; margin: 0;\">Subsea and topside hydraulic cylinders serving Aberdeen&#8217;s oil and gas sector face arguably the most demanding conditions any actuator encounters: saltwater spray, hydrogen sulphide exposure, wave-induced shock loading, and temperature cycling from -20\u00b0C to +80\u00b0C across a single operational shift. The combination of high force density (critical for riser tensioner and subsea manifold actuator sizing), inherent shock absorption through fluid compressibility, and the availability of fire-resistant fluid options (HWCF, HWBF) ensures that hydraulic cylinders remain the dominant actuation technology offshore. HVOF tungsten carbide rod coatings have largely replaced hard chrome in North Sea applications, driven by REACH regulations on hexavalent chromium and the superior corrosion performance demonstrated in accelerated saltwater spray testing.<\/p>\n<\/div>\n<p><!-- App Card 4 --><\/p>\n<div style=\"flex: 1 1 260px; min-width: 0; background: #f4f7fb; border-radius: 14px; padding: 3%; box-sizing: border-box; border-left: 5px solid #8e44ad; transition: transform 0.25s, box-shadow 0.25s;\">\n<div style=\"font-size: clamp(22px,3vw,30px);\">\ud83d\ude97<\/div>\n<div style=\"font-weight: bold; color: #8e44ad; font-size: clamp(14px,2vw,17px); margin: 6px 0 8px;\">Automotive Stamping &amp; Press Lines \u2014 Birmingham, West Midlands<\/div>\n<p style=\"font-size: clamp(12px,1.6vw,14px); color: #34495e; line-height: 1.8; margin: 0;\">Birmingham&#8217;s automotive component manufacturing base \u2014 centred on Tier 1 and Tier 2 suppliers to Jaguar Land Rover and the broader Midlands vehicle manufacturing cluster \u2014 makes extensive use of hydraulic cylinders in transfer press die clamping, blankholder actuation, and hydraulic overload protection systems. Press forces from 400 tonnes to 2,500 tonnes are achieved through carefully engineered cylinder arrays integrated into press ram and bolster designs. The inherent overload compliance of a hydraulic system \u2014 where exceeding the set relief pressure causes the circuit to bypass rather than catastrophically fail \u2014 provides a critical machine protection function that electric actuators cannot replicate without sophisticated external force-limiting hardware.<\/p>\n<\/div>\n<p><!-- App Card 5 --><\/p>\n<div style=\"flex: 1 1 260px; min-width: 0; background: #f4f7fb; border-radius: 14px; padding: 3%; box-sizing: border-box; border-left: 5px solid #c0392b; transition: transform 0.25s, box-shadow 0.25s;\">\n<div style=\"font-size: clamp(22px,3vw,30px);\">\ud83c\udfd7\ufe0f<\/div>\n<div style=\"font-weight: bold; color: #c0392b; font-size: clamp(14px,2vw,17px); margin: 6px 0 8px;\">Civil Engineering &amp; Infrastructure \u2014 UK National Road &amp; Rail<\/div>\n<p style=\"font-size: clamp(12px,1.6vw,14px); color: #34495e; line-height: 1.8; margin: 0;\">Ground improvement equipment, tunnel boring machines, bridge hydraulic jacks, and lock gate actuators across UK canal and river navigation infrastructure all depend on hydraulic cylinders. The working environment \u2014 abrasive dust, paper fibres, glass fragments, and the mechanical shock of dense waste compaction \u2014 creates a hostile setting where electric linear actuators with exposed screw assemblies accumulate contamination rapidly. Purpose-designed cylinders with extended wiper rings, labyrinth seal systems, and heavily chromed or ceramic-coated rods are specified for refuse applications. The sheer compaction forces involved \u2014 400\u20131,200 kN in commercial baler applications \u2014 place these applications firmly in hydraulic territory for the foreseeable future.<\/p>\n<\/div>\n<\/div>\n<\/div>\n<p><!-- SECTION: IMAGE ROW --><\/p>\n<div style=\"width: 100%; max-width: 100%; min-width: 100%; background: #0a1628; padding: 2% 4%; box-sizing: border-box;\">\n<div style=\"display: flex; flex-wrap: wrap; gap: 12px; box-sizing: border-box;\">\n<div style=\"flex: 1 1 180px; min-width: 0;\"><img decoding=\"async\" style=\"width: 100%; max-width: 100%; height: auto; border-radius: 8px; display: block;\" src=\"https:\/\/boom-cylinders.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/09\/ep-boom-cylinders.com-3-1-1.webp\" alt=\"Industrial hydraulic cylinder application\" title=\"\"><\/div>\n<div style=\"flex: 1 1 180px; min-width: 0;\"><img decoding=\"async\" style=\"width: 100%; max-width: 100%; height: auto; border-radius: 8px; display: block;\" src=\"https:\/\/boom-cylinders.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/09\/ep-boom-cylinders.com-8-1-1.webp\" alt=\"Hydraulic boom cylinder precision engineering\" title=\"\"><\/div>\n<\/div>\n<\/div>\n<p><!-- SECTION: MAKING THE RIGHT CHOICE --><\/p>\n<div style=\"width: 100%; max-width: 100%; min-width: 100%; background: #fff; padding: 3% 4%; box-sizing: border-box;\">\n<h2 style=\"font-size: clamp(18px, 3vw + 6px, 30px); color: #0a1628; margin: 0 0 20px 0; padding-bottom: 10px; border-bottom: 3px solid #27ae60;\">Decision Framework: How to Choose Between a Hydraulic Cylinder and a Linear Actuator<\/h2>\n<p style=\"font-size: clamp(13px,1.8vw,16px); color: #34495e; line-height: 1.85; margin: 0 0 20px 0;\">Rather than treating this as a binary technology competition, experienced engineers approach the choice by mapping application requirements against capability boundaries. If your application demands forces above 150 kN, operates in high-temperature or shock-loaded environments, or requires static load holding without electrical power, a hydraulic cylinder is almost always the right solution. If precision below \u00b10.1 mm and energy efficiency above 85% are the primary drivers \u2014 and maximum force stays within 100\u2013150 kN \u2014 an electric actuator may serve better. An electric actuator holding a loaded boom at height requires a motor brake \u2014 a mechanically and electrically more complex solution with more failure modes.
